Gophers Score Late to Take Down No. 23 Maryland

4/10/2022 4:11:00 PM | Baseball

Brady Counsell tripled and scored on a wild pitch in the bottom of the eighth

MINNEAPOLIS -- Minnesota scored the game-winning run in the bottom of the eighth to defeat No. 23 Maryland 4-3 on Sunday afternoon at Siebert Field.

With the game tied 3-3 and two outs in the bottom of the eighth, freshman second baseman Brady Counsell tripled down the right field line and scored the eventual game-winning run on a passed ball. Minnesota (9-20, 1-5 Big Ten) had previously led for the entire game until Maryland (25-7, 4-2 Big Ten) tied it up at three with two runs in the top of the seventh.

Gophers right-hander Aidan Maldonado (1-3) went 6.0 innings, striking out five and allowing seven hits and just one earned run. Maryland's Jason Savacool (5-2) allowed three earned runs, four hits and struck out seven in 7.0 innings. Both had no decisions. Gophers sophomore Noah DeLuga (1-0) earned the win while Tom Skoro tallied his first save as a Gopher.

As a team, Minnesota had five hits, with Boston Merila and Drew Stahl both tallying one hit each with RBI doubles. Maryland scatted 10 hits across nine innings.

Minnesota started out hot, striking with two runs in the bottom of the first. Brett Bateman started the game with a leadoff single and came around to score after Drew Stahl slashed a double into the left field corner. Stahl, who advanced to third on the relay throw to the plate as the Terps tried to get Bateman at home, scored after Jack Kelly grounded out to first.

Maryland got one back in the top of the second when Troy Schreffler doubled to right center, scoring Matt Shaw. Shaw had singled to leadoff the inning. 

The Gophers scored their third run in the fourth inning to go up 3-1. Andrew Wilhite drew a two-out walk before Boston Merila drilled a double into the left center gap, scoring Wilhite from first.

Maldonado brought his best stuff on Sunday, shutting the Terps down in his final 4.0 innings of work. He worked out of jams and stranded four in the third and fourth innings combined. He worked around a hit-by-pitch in the fifth and a single in the sixth to hold the visitors at bay once again.

Freshman right-hander Seth Clausen replaced Maldonado in the seventh inning and ran into some trouble. After inducing a groundout to start the inning, he walked the second batter. UMD's Luke Shliger and Chris Alleyne then hit back-to-back singles, with the latter driving in a run to cut the Gophers lead to 3-2. Clausen was then replaced by sophomore southpaw Noah DeLuga. An RBI single by Nick Lorusso scored Shliger to tie the game at 3-3. DeLuga responded positively, striking out the next hitter and inducing a groundout to second to strand a pair in scoring position and keep the game tied. 

After being held scoreless in the seventh, Minnesota finally broke through in the eighth when Counsell looped his triple into the right field corner. UMD right fielder Troy Schreffler dove to try and catch the slicing ball down the line but came up empty. Chase Stanke came to the plate next and on the second pitch, a passed ball allowed Counsell to score and the Gophers re-took the lead.

Gophers redshirt senior left-hander Tom Skoro earned his first save as a Gopher, striking out the side for a perfect 1-2-3 ninth inning.
